These buttons will enable you to launch the editor in which you will be able to write the Visual Basic Code and will also allow you to directly create windows-style controls like textboxes, push buttons, labels, radio buttons, checkboxes etc. In order to get access to the VBA script editor, you first need to make the corresponding buttons available on the Excel toolbars (they are not there by default). ![]() Other methods always require the installation of an ActiveX, or at least the registration of an “.ocx” file, like for instance the MSComm control. Introduction The great advantage of this method, which uses API functions to call the serial port directly, is that you do not really need to install anything on your PC, apart from the Excel itself (which, let’s admit it, already exists on most PCs). The purpose of this article is to demonstrate how you can perform serial port communication in the VBA (Visual Basic Applications – script editor included in any typical Microsoft Excel distribution) but without using the MSComm control or any other third party add-on or ActiveX.
